Students at BCI Academy recently marked the end of the school year with a Parents’ Day celebration. Our kindergarten graduates wore caps and gowns and shared poems expressing their feelings about BCI. They enjoyed performing a song for their parents and showed excitement at their achievement.
Principal Mulugeta gave a speech to the crowd highlighting the accomplishments of the students. He also recognized exemplary teachers and parents.
It takes cooperation from the parents, students, and staff, as well as support from our sponsorship family to help the students progress and fulfill their potential. Parents’ Day was a special time for all to celebrate the outcome of their hard work.
